Miner injured during tacitly encouraged laundry activity


The Queensland Industrial Relations Court has determined that a worker, who herniated a disc while carrying his washing, is eligible for compensation with respect to his injury because it occurred during an overall period of employment while undertaking an activity tacitly encouraged by his employer.
